Our fall sensory bin was a BIG hit! I loaded it up with autumn color fusion beads. They made a great “main” part of the bin and added lots of color & interest.  In the box were leaves, cork flowers (texture), old nutmeg spice container that still smelled, acorns (which Minnie LOVED counting and moving around)

Pumpkins that the kids enjoyed picking up with large tongs

Cinnamon sticks to smell & red ribbon to practice tying with

Feathers to sort, touch & TICKLE!

Foam fall shaped beads to sort, organize, touch, and feel.

Goofy enjoyed stringing the fusion beads on a shoe lace to make a necklace. They were so small it ended up being a great fine motor activity for him!
